A pedestrian safety system is a technology that is designed to enhance the safety of pedestrians on the road. These systems utilize various sensors, cameras, and other advanced technologies to detect the presence of pedestrians and alert drivers of their presence. By providing real-time warnings and alerts, pedestrian safety systems aim to reduce the number of accidents and improve overall road safety for both pedestrians and drivers.
One of the key components of a pedestrian safety system is pedestrian detection technology. This technology uses sensors and cameras to detect the presence of pedestrians near a vehicle. When a pedestrian is detected, the system alerts the driver through visual or auditory cues, prompting them to slow down or stop to avoid a potential collision. This real-time feedback can significantly reduce the risk of accidents and save lives on the road.
Another important feature of a pedestrian safety system is automatic emergency braking (AEB). AEB is a technology that automatically applies the brakes when a potential collision with a pedestrian is detected. This system can help mitigate the severity of accidents and reduce the likelihood of injuries or fatalities. By providing an additional layer of protection, AEB enhances the safety of both pedestrians and drivers on the road.
